What makes chimney cap replacement in Grimsby its own problem

Homes in Grimsby rarely fail all at once — they fail slowly, through one heating season at a time.

Air-sealing and window upgrades have made Grimsby homes far tighter than they were designed to be, and a tight house starves a natural-draft appliance of the make-up air it needs.

Snow load and ice damming stress the roof-to-wall junction each winter; by spring the sealant that was doing the work has usually torn.

Across Baker, Winston, Casablanca Waterfront, Nelles and Doran, the housing stock changes street by street, and the correct method changes with it. A century home with a soft-brick stack does not get the same treatment as a 2010 build with a factory-built vent — using one method on both is how systems get damaged.

the practical takeaway is that a chimney cap replacement visit should start with an assessment, not a tool. Any crew that begins work before telling you what they found is guessing on your behalf.

Seasonal timing for Grimsby homeowners

If your chimney cap replacement need is not urgent, aim for the shoulder months. Crews are unhurried, materials behave, and any follow-up work can still be completed before the heating season starts.

SeasonWhat to expect
Spring (Mar–May)Best availability and pricing. Ideal for repairs — mortar cures properly above 5°C.
Summer (Jun–Aug)Quietest window. Best time for rebuilds, liner work and any project needing multiple days.
Early fall (Sep–Oct)Peak demand begins. Book 2–3 weeks ahead to secure a date before first fire.
Winter (Nov–Feb)Emergency and diagnostic work only for most exterior repairs; interior service continues.

What you can do yourself — and what you shouldn't

Plenty of this is homeowner work. Walk the exterior twice a year with a phone camera, keep the termination clear, note anything that changed since the last set of photos, and you will catch most problems while they are still cheap.

Where DIY stops is anywhere a mistake is invisible. A flue that looks clean from below can still hold glazed creosote out of sight. A vent that moves air can still be running at half its rated flow. A crack sealed from the outside can trap the water it was meant to shed.

The practical split most Grimsby homeowners land on: handle the visual monitoring yourself, and book a certified inspection annually so the invisible half is documented by someone carrying $5M liability coverage.

Can I just install a cap myself?+

Big-box caps are often the wrong size and use galvanized steel that rusts within a few seasons. A custom-fitted cap with proper fasteners and sealant protects your flue for decades and is the safer choice.

How do I know if my chimney cap needs replacing?+

Rust stains on the chimney, visible holes, a missing cap, or water/debris inside the firebox are all signs. Our free inspection confirms whether replacement or just resealing is needed.

Will a new cap fix my smoky fireplace?+

If downdrafts or wind are pushing smoke back into your home, a properly designed cap with wind-resistant baffles often solves the problem. We test draft before and after installation.

What materials do you offer?+

We stock 304 and 316 stainless-steel caps with black powder-coat or natural finishes, plus solid copper caps for heritage and high-end homes. All carry a lifetime warranty.
